From 4541ee4363066dfc55e7c78d9b54f64a15301ae7 Mon Sep 17 00:00:00 2001 From: Robert Kaussow Date: Sun, 3 Sep 2023 12:57:30 +0000 Subject: [PATCH] remove readonly option mc_forwarding --- _docs/index.md | 139 +++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 139 insertions(+) create mode 100644 _docs/index.md diff --git a/_docs/index.md b/_docs/index.md new file mode 100644 index 0000000..b2b52fc --- /dev/null +++ b/_docs/index.md @@ -0,0 +1,139 @@ +--- +title: kernel +type: docs +--- + +[![Source Code](https://img.shields.io/badge/gitea-source%20code-blue?logo=gitea&logoColor=white)](https://gitea.rknet.org/ansible/xoxys.kernel) +[![Build Status](https://img.shields.io/drone/build/ansible/xoxys.kernel?logo=drone&server=https%3A%2F%2Fdrone.rknet.org)](https://drone.rknet.org/ansible/xoxys.kernel) +[![License: MIT](https://img.shields.io/badge/license-MIT-blue.svg)](https://gitea.rknet.org/ansible/xoxys.kernel/src/branch/main/LICENSE) + +Configure kernel parameters and coredump settings. + + + +- [Requirements](#requirements) +- [Default Variables](#default-variables) + - [kernel_blacklist_modules](#kernel_blacklist_modules) + - [kernel_coredump_enabled](#kernel_coredump_enabled) + - [kernel_custom_config](#kernel_custom_config) + - [kernel_disable_modules](#kernel_disable_modules) + - [kernel_ipv4_forwarding_enabled](#kernel_ipv4_forwarding_enabled) + - [kernel_ipv4_ping_group_range](#kernel_ipv4_ping_group_range) + - [kernel_ipv6_enabled](#kernel_ipv6_enabled) + - [kernel_ipv6_forwarding_enabled](#kernel_ipv6_forwarding_enabled) + - [kernel_namespace_support_enabled](#kernel_namespace_support_enabled) +- [Dependencies](#dependencies) + +--- + +## Requirements + +- Minimum Ansible version: `2.1` + +## Default Variables + +### kernel_blacklist_modules + +#### Default value + +```YAML +kernel_blacklist_modules: [] +``` + +### kernel_coredump_enabled + +#### Default value + +```YAML +kernel_coredump_enabled: true +``` + +### kernel_custom_config + +#### Default value + +```YAML +kernel_custom_config: [] +``` + +#### Example usage + +```YAML +kernel_custom_config: + - file: 90-example + content: + - name: vm.panic_on_oom + value: 0 + - name: vm.overcommit_memory + value: 1 +``` + +### kernel_disable_modules + +#### Default value + +```YAML +kernel_disable_modules: + - usb-storage + - firewire-core + - dccp + - sctp + - tipc + - rds + - bluetooth + - cramfs + - squashfs + - udf +``` + +### kernel_ipv4_forwarding_enabled + +#### Default value + +```YAML +kernel_ipv4_forwarding_enabled: false +``` + +### kernel_ipv4_ping_group_range + +#### Default value + +```YAML +kernel_ipv4_ping_group_range: _unset +``` + +#### Example usage + +```YAML +kernel_ipv4_ping_group_range: 0 2000000 +``` + +### kernel_ipv6_enabled + +#### Default value + +```YAML +kernel_ipv6_enabled: false +``` + +### kernel_ipv6_forwarding_enabled + +#### Default value + +```YAML +kernel_ipv6_forwarding_enabled: false +``` + +### kernel_namespace_support_enabled + +#### Default value + +```YAML +kernel_namespace_support_enabled: false +``` + + + +## Dependencies + +None.